Output ea8c515af278710fa64cc3e6c67fd14930611b207662f6a7da1d06d9fa2059d1:3

value
148026
script pubkey
OP_0 OP_PUSHBYTES_20 39f67b95cbf91f6bca0d77e9bafbb1e648e8b25a
address
bc1q88m8h9wtly0khjsdwl5m47a3ueyw3vj6rfynl7
transaction
ea8c515af278710fa64cc3e6c67fd14930611b207662f6a7da1d06d9fa2059d1
spent
true